Rainforest Zipline Park: 

This has 8 double cable lines for the riders. It covers about 29,000 acres of the area through the trees of the Yunque National Forest. This is the only tropical rainforest in the United States National Forest Systems

The line provides a stunning view of the rainforest. Apart from that, the staff is dedicated to safety and amiability. They will make you stay tuned to their amazing commentary, giving you the details of the trip and the vicinity.

Many experts say the course is suited for the first-timers as well. The tour lasts for about 2 hours. They also combine the zip line activity with rock and wall climbing at the Rainforest zipline part. 

JungleQui Zipline Park:

It has 11 ziplines in its aerial expedition. These are string over trees and several pairs of rappels from elevated platforms. There is also a short hike from some parts of El Yunque. The tour-guides have a reputation of being friendly, enthusiastic, and helpful. The jungle view is also very mesmerizing.

Yunque Ziplining 

There are half a dozen zip lines that are located on a private mountainous rainforest setting. The lengths are around 400 to 1000 feet. It is about a 3-hour tour. There is also a 10-minute educational hike. The guides then tell about the local culture, the plantation, animals, and the beautiful landscape.

Batey Zipline Adventures

Tourists can expect three different zip line excursions. One of the three lines offer 3,200 feet in total, a 150-foot suspension bridge including hiking, kayaking, rappelling and swimming. It is a half-day tour. The classical tour can be extended to visit a waterfall and exploration a cave. The guides are also enthusiastic. 

Ecoquest Adventures and Tours

This includes five zip lines through the canopy bridges and a hike to the forest for about 15 minutes. The zip lining leads to a mojito bar where one can buy drinks with some additional fee. The view is known to be remarkable and also the guides are reputed for their knowledge about the surrounding.

ToroVerde Adventure Park

It consists of eight-line zips, and the tour lasts for about 3 hours. It is located in the mountainous region of Puerto Rico in Orocovis. The landscape is impressive, and the guides are no doubt helpful.
